(S) At 1730 hours of February 21, 2008, Charge Sison convened a meeting of the Core Emergency Action Committee (EAC). Present were DCM, RSO and GRPO. ¶2. (S) Core EAC discussed the anonymous phone threat to the Embassy of Kuwait in Beirut. On the morning of Thursday, February 21, 2008 an anonymous called telephoned the Embassy of Kuwait and stated that two rockets would be fired at the Embassy and that all occupants should leave immediately. Lebanese Armed Forces (LAF) and Lebanese Internal Security Forces (ISF) responded to the scene. The Embassy of Kuwait is under renovation and was not fully occupied. Contacts within ISF told Embassy officers that the call was a hoax and that the call may have been prompted by the incident in Kuwait where a commemoration was held for Imad Mugniyeh. Some Shiite Members of Parliament are being sued by four Kuwaiti lawyers regarding the commemoration ceremony. The ISF will investigate the hoax to determine who made the call. ¶3. (S) Core EAC also discussed a letter that was sent to Embassy Beirut's Public Diplomacy Section on Thursday, February 21, 2008 by the Al Anwar newspaper. Al Anwar received a letter in Arabic from a group that calls themselves "The Sons And Those Who Love Hajj Radwan in Lebanon (NOTE: Hajj Radwan was an alias for Imad Muniyeh). The letter states "February 12 is not like February 14 or 15 or any other day after February 12. We are now standing before a decision and a pledge we took. ISRAEL and its interests are our target, the US, its centers, its citizens and its Embassy will only encounter, after today, anger and fire particularly this area which is over our chests in Awkar. Let them start packing their things and prepare to leave. We do not want those who are killing us and those who are assisting them over our land. After today, we will not allow them to move freely in our areas and allow them to spread their poison among our families. This is a promise and a pledge. Death is coming and burning fire will burn the land under their feet. We have warned them" The group is not known to the Embassy. GRPO and RSO are in contact with their respective counterparts to further investigate this unknown group. Given that threat is not yet substantiated and credibility of the group is unknown, Core EAC decided not to upgrade security procedures at this time. Embassy Beirut already operates at a high level of readiness. Core EAC will monitor the situation as more information becomes known. ¶4. (SBU) RSO expressed concern that with the current restrictions on unofficial moves, some travel patterns were becoming too familiar. For example, there were many moves to the City Mall shopping complex and to shopping areas north of the embassy. RSO recommended that the area for unofficial moves be extended south to the ABC Mall in Ashrafiye. This will be for the mall only; travel to other sites in Ashrafiye such as restaurants and bars is still not an available option for unofficial moves. This area is located approximately 10 kilometers from the US Embassy in Awkar. The action will mean Embassy staff are moving in different directions for shopping and movements are less predictable. Core EAC approved this recommendation effective the weekend of February 23-4. SISON
